Getting Down to Business: How We Do It
To begin, we start by carefully preparing your existing concrete slab, making sure it’s all ready for its big makeover. This often means clearing things out and giving it a good initial clean. Hence, a smooth start makes for a smooth finish, every single time.
Next up, we use special machines with diamond-impregnated tools to grind down the surface. This step progressively refines the concrete, removing imperfections and making it flatter and smoother. So basically, it’s like sanding wood, but for concrete, getting it ready for that awesome sheen.
After that, we apply a special liquid, called a densifier, which soaks into the concrete and makes it even harder and more resistant. This stuff is pretty neat because it actually changes the concrete’s makeup, making it super tough from the inside out. In turn, your floor gains incredible strength and longevity.
Finally, we go through several more grinding and polishing stages with finer and finer grits until we hit the desired level of gloss. Some folks like a subtle satin look, while others want a super high-gloss, mirror-like effect. Consequently, you get to pick the exact finish that works best for your personal style and needs.

Polished concrete floors in Knightsville, Indiana
Property owners in Knightsville, Indiana usually call after looking at a tired concrete slab in a warehouse, showroom or modern residential space. Polished concrete is the existing slab itself, mechanically refined through a series of diamond-grinding passes from coarse (40 grit) to fine (3000 grit), with a densifier and stain guard applied at the right stage.
The result is the original slab transformed into a hard, dense, reflective surface that reads as polished stone. There is no coating sitting on top, so there is nothing that can chip, peel or hot-tire fail. The slab is the floor.

How much does polished concrete cost in Knightsville, Indiana?
Standard cream-polish residential and light-duty runs $4 to $7 per square foot. Showroom mirror-grade with aggregate exposure and dye is $7 to $12 per square foot. Warehouse-scale (10,000+ sq ft) drops to $3 to $5 range. Quoted firm after the call.
How is this different from epoxy?
Epoxy is a coating that sits on top of the slab. Polished concrete is the slab itself, ground and densified. Epoxy can chip, peel, hot-tire pickup. Polished concrete cannot, there is no coating to fail.

How long does the install take?
Residential rooms run two to three days. larger floors 5,000 to 20,000 sq ft run a week to two weeks. The space is dust-controlled with wet grinding and HEPA vacuum.
